Abstract
A method and system for adjusting the gain of an output from a replacement component in a system with plural components responsive to changing operating conditions so that a power level of an output from the system is approximately the same as a power level of an output from the system before installation of the replacement component. A system memory stores a relationship of gain responsive to changing operating conditions for each of plural components in the system, and each replacement component has a component memory for storing a relationship of gain responsive to changing operating conditions. The relationship stored in the component memory is copied to the system memory when the replacement component is installed in the system. A feedback voltage for adjusting the gain of the output from the replacement component is varied in response to the relationships stored in the system memory so that the power level of the output from the system is substantially unchanged by installation of the replacement component.

11. An RF communication system for receiving an RF signal and converting the received signal to an intermediate frequency at a predetermined power level, the system comprising:
-
a low noise coupler and an intermediate frequency amplifier connected in series, each having a gain that is responsive to a feedback voltage and which affects the predetermined power level; a system memory for storing a relationship of gain to an operating condition as a function of feedback voltage for each of said low noise coupler and said intermediate frequency amplifier; a replacement component with a component memory for storing a relationship of gain to an operating condition as a function of feedback voltage of said replacement component, said replacement component for replacing one of said low noise coupler and said intermediate frequency amplifier; means for providing said relationship stored in said component memory to said system memory when said replacement component is installed in the system; and means for adjusting the feedback voltage for said replacement component responsive to said relationships stored in said system memory so that the predetermined power level is substantially unchanged by installation of said replacement component. - View Dependent Claims (12, 13, 14)
